Maikaʻi ka holomua o ka hoʻomohala ʻana o ka sensor infrared

Hoʻopuka kēlā me kēia mea me ka mahana ma luna o ka zero loa i ka ikehu i ka lewa waho ma ke ʻano o ka mālamalama infrared. ʻO ka ʻenehana ʻike e hoʻohana ana i ka radiation infrared e ana i nā nui kino pili i kapa ʻia ʻo ka ʻenehana ʻike infrared.

ʻO ka ʻenehana sensor infrared kekahi o nā ʻenehana e ulu wikiwiki nei i nā makahiki i hala iho nei, ua hoʻohana nui ʻia ka sensor infrared i ka aerospace, astronomy, meteorology, koa, ʻoihana a me nā ʻoihana kīwila a me nā ʻoihana ʻē aʻe, e pāʻani ana i kahi kuleana koʻikoʻi nui. ʻO ka infrared, ma ke ʻano, he ʻano nalu radiation electromagnetic, ʻo kona laulā wavelength ma kahi o 0.78m ~ 1000m spectrum, no ka mea aia ia i loko o ka mālamalama ʻike ʻia ma waho o ke kukui ʻulaʻula, i kapa ʻia ʻo infrared. ʻO kēlā me kēia mea me ka mahana ma luna o ka zero absolute e hoʻolaha i ka ikehu i ka lewa waho ma ke ʻano o ka mālamalama infrared. ʻO ka ʻenehana sensor e hoʻohana ana i ka radiation infrared e ana i nā nui kino pili i kapa ʻia ʻo ka ʻenehana sensor infrared.

ʻO ke sensor infrared photonic kahi ʻano sensor e hana ana ma ka hoʻohana ʻana i ka hopena photon o ka radiation infrared. ʻO ka mea i kapa ʻia ʻo ka hopena photon e pili ana i ka wā e loaʻa ai kahi hanana infrared ma kekahi mau mea semiconductor, e launa pū ana ke kahe photon i loko o ka radiation infrared me nā electrons i loko o ka mea semiconductor, e hoʻololi ana i ke kūlana ikehu o nā electrons, e hopena ana i nā hanana uila like ʻole. Ma ke ana ʻana i nā loli i nā waiwai uila o nā mea semiconductor, hiki iā ʻoe ke ʻike i ka ikaika o ka radiation infrared e pili ana. ʻO nā ʻano nui o nā mea ʻike photon he photodetector kūloko, photodetector waho, mea ʻike lawe manuahi, mea ʻike lua quantum QWIP a pēlā aku. Ua māhele hou ʻia nā photodetectors kūloko i ke ʻano photoconductive, ke ʻano hana photovolt a me ke ʻano photomagnetoelectric. ʻO nā ʻano nui o ka mea ʻike photon he ʻike kiʻekiʻe, ka wikiwiki pane wikiwiki, a me ke alapine pane kiʻekiʻe, akā ʻo ka hemahema, he haiki ka hui ʻike, a hana maʻamau ia i nā mahana haʻahaʻa (i mea e mālama ai i ka ʻike kiʻekiʻe, hoʻohana pinepine ʻia ka nitrogen wai a i ʻole ka refrigeration thermoelectric e hoʻomaʻalili i ka mea ʻike photon i kahi mahana hana haʻahaʻa).

ʻO ka mea hana loiloi ʻāpana e pili ana i ka ʻenehana spectrum infrared he mau ʻano ʻōmaʻomaʻo, wikiwiki, ʻaʻole luku a pūnaewele, a ʻo ia kekahi o ka hoʻomohala wikiwiki ʻana o ka ʻenehana loiloi ʻenehana kiʻekiʻe ma ke kahua o ka kemika analytical. He nui nā molekala kinoea i haku ʻia me nā diatoms asymmetric a me nā polyatoms he mau kāʻei omo like i loko o ka kāʻei radiation infrared, a ʻokoʻa ka wavelength a me ka ikaika o ka omo ʻana o nā kāʻei omo ma muli o nā molekala like ʻole i loko o nā mea i ana ʻia. Wahi a ka hoʻolaha ʻana o nā kāʻei omo o nā molekala kinoea like ʻole a me ka ikaika o ka omo ʻana, hiki ke ʻike ʻia ka haku mele a me ka ʻike o nā molekala kinoea i loko o ka mea i ana ʻia. Hoʻohana ʻia ka mea loiloi kinoea infrared e hoʻomālamalama i ka medium i ana ʻia me ka mālamalama infrared, a e like me nā ʻano omo infrared o nā media molekala like ʻole, me ka hoʻohana ʻana i nā ʻano spectrum omo infrared o ke kinoea, ma o ka loiloi spectral e hoʻokō ai i ka haku mele kinoea a i ʻole ka loiloi concentration.

Hiki ke loaʻa ka spectrum diagnostic o ka hydroxyl, ka wai, ka carbonate, Al-OH, Mg-OH, Fe-OH a me nā pilina molekala ʻē aʻe ma o ka irradiation infrared o ka mea i manaʻo ʻia, a laila hiki ke ana ʻia a kālailai ʻia ke kūlana wavelength, ka hohonu a me ka laulā o ka spectrum e loaʻa ai kona ʻano, nā ʻāpana a me ka ratio o nā mea metala nui. No laila, hiki ke hoʻokō ʻia ka loiloi haku mele o nā media paʻa.
